MANILA, Philippines — The Department of Foreign Affairs (DFA) said that there were no Filipinos either among the fatalities or those seriously injured in the tour-bus accident that occurred on in upstate New York on Aug. 22, 2025 (local time).

The crash left five people dead and at least 49 others were injured when a chartered bus overturned along the New York State Thruway near Pembroke, roughly 30 miles east of Buffalo.
The confirmation followed inquiries made by The Manila Times and the public amid reports that many of the passengers were of Asian descent, including individuals from China, India, and the Philippines.

"At present, there are no reports of Filipino nationals among the deceased or seriously injured," a DFA official said on Saturday. "We continue to coordinate with the Philippine Consulate General in New York, which remains in close contact with US authorities."
